Transaction 85f304fe6ff3db3261858d9d3f72203a12c1ef2a36a3b72a7db0f8a8ceb9ae99
1 Input
1 Output
-
85f304fe6ff3db3261858d9d3f72203a12c1ef2a36a3b72a7db0f8a8ceb9ae99:0
- value
- 43240775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73976a76f30c8682848f86f8b2dba788c8910bfa OP_EQUAL
- address
- MJSML3sShrzGSAhf2bwY96xos9m7JrjGDK